Accent Walls: Make a Statement
Make a vibrant statement in your home by painting one wall a lively shade to produce an accent wall that promptly stands out.
Accent wall surfaces are an amazing means to include individuality and design to an area without frustrating the room. Pick a shade that enhances the existing decoration while likewise making a striking contrast. Take into consideration shades like deep navy, emerald green, or even a bold coral reefs to create a focal point in the area.
When choosing the wall to accent, go with the one that normally draws attention, such as the wall surface behind the bed in a bedroom or the one behind the couch in a living room.
Color Obstructing Methods
Using different colors to split a wall right into distinct geometric forms is a preferred method referred to as shade barring. This method includes a modern and vibrant touch to your home decoration, instantly transforming a plain wall surface into a strong statement piece.
To accomplish this appearance, pick 2 or even more contrasting colors that match each other well. Think about utilizing painter's tape to develop tidy lines and exact edges in between the different shade sections. Experiment with different shapes like squares, rectangles, and even a lot more abstract types to produce visual passion and deepness.
Shade obstructing works specifically well in spaces with basic furniture and minimalistic decor, as it can serve as a centerpiece that links the space together. Keep in mind to stabilize the colors and maintain the total color pattern of the room in mind to ensure a cohesive look.
With shade stopping, you can unleash your creative thinking and overhaul your home with a fresh, modern style.
Creative Patterns and Styles
Checking out innovative patterns and designs can bring a distinct and personalized touch to your home's interior decoration. Going with geometric shapes like chevron, herringbone, or quatrefoil can add a modern-day and dynamic feel to your wall surfaces. Think about using painter's tape to create crisp lines and achieve a professional-looking finish. For a vibrant statement, think about a mural or accent wall with a striking pattern such as a Moroccan trellis, an exotic jungle, or an abstract design. These eye-catching attributes can end up being the prime focus of a space and work as a discussion starter. Don't be afraid to blend and match different patterns to create an aesthetically stimulating room, but remember to balance busy patterns with solid shades or neutrals to avoid overwhelming the room.
Whether you choose to repaint an entire space with a detailed pattern or merely include a subtle style component, integrating creative patterns and layouts into your home's interior paint can genuinely change the atmosphere and display your private style.
